>>> >> My personal policy is to give tor uses in #ubuntu channels that have a
>>> >> tor ban, a +e (exemption from ban)[op up, /mode #ubuntu +e USERNAME ]
>>> >> this exempts them from all bans/quiets/etc, so be very sure you know
>>> >> the person you are setting +e.  The flip side of that is, if the +e
>>> >> setting is abused, they can assume they will not be allowed back in
>>> >> for a nice long time.
